Dawnblade Ceramic Dice: Worth the Hype?
The new Dawnblade ceramic dice have sparked quite a buzz throughout the tabletop gaming community, but are they really worth the premium price tag? Many claim that their stunning visual appeal – featuring intricate designs and a satisfying heft – is ample justification. However, some gamers find the significant cost prohibitive, especially considering they are primarily decorative and don't necessarily offer improved gameplay. Ultimately, whether these dice are worth it depends on your get more info individual priorities: if you’re a collector or value aesthetics above all else, the Dawnblade dice might be a worthwhile addition, but for more budget-conscious individuals, other options may provide better value.
